What It Is

Breathing Class is a breathing training and education platform operated by The Breathing Class LLC and founded by clinical psychologist and author Dr. Belisa Vranich. Its core approach is not traditional meditation-style breathing relaxation, but instead starts from breathing-related structures such as the diaphragm, intercostal muscles, and pelvic floor, emphasizing a “biomechanically correct” breathing pattern. The website primarily promotes its free BIQ Assessment for evaluating breathing quality, as well as the Five & Five five-day breathing retraining program.

Core Courses and Methodology

The platform claims that the BIQ Assessment is based on more than 20 years of clinical research, is a validated tool for measuring breathing quality, and covers 12 biomechanical indicators. The Five & Five method uses five core exercises performed across five daily training sessions to help users shift from chest-and-shoulder-dominant “vertical breathing” to lateral breathing that better matches human anatomy. The course is delivered through guided at-home videos and requires no equipment, app, or hardware. It also provides BIQ assessments before and after training to track changes. The website supports English / Español.

Instructor and Institutional Background

Dr. Vranich holds a doctorate in clinical psychology from New York University, completed an internship at Bellevue Hospital, and has been in clinical practice since 2000. The site states that her method has served more than 15,000 people, with clients including U.S. special forces, Olympic athletes, Fortune 500 executives, first responders, college athletes, and patients in healthcare systems. She has also taught at institutions such as UCLA, Swarthmore College, and the U.S. Department of Justice. This provides a certain level of professional credibility for the course.

Pricing and Service Scope

The BIQ Assessment is clearly stated to be free. Specific pricing, payment plans, and refund terms for paid courses, certifications, or other products are not disclosed in the captured content; it only states that they will be shown before purchase. The terms of service clearly state that the content is a health and educational tool and does not constitute medical advice, diagnosis, or treatment. Users with cardiovascular, respiratory, or mental health conditions, those who are pregnant, or those recovering after surgery should consult a qualified medical professional first.

Pros and Cons

The advantages are that the methodology is clearly positioned and distinct from generalized relaxation training; the free assessment lowers the barrier to trying it; and the guided at-home video format is user-friendly for general users. The drawbacks are limited pricing transparency and limited disclosure of paid programs and certification details. The BIQ assessment relies on user self-reporting, and the platform does not guarantee accuracy or specific results. There is also no clear information about Chinese-language content, Chinese customer support, or access performance from China.

Who It’s For and Access from China

It is better suited to people who want to systematically improve their breathing mechanics and support stress, sleep, anxiety, and athletic performance management. It may also be suitable for users in high-pressure professions or athletic settings. If users have specific illnesses or symptoms, they should treat it as educational supplemental training rather than a replacement for medical care.
